摘要:
A fluorinated carbazole, 9,9'-[2,2'-bis(trifluoromethyl)biphenyl-4,4'-diyl]bis(9H-carbazole) (6FCBP) was prepared, which exhibited better solubility compared to the well-known hole-transporting material 4,4'-bis(carbazol-9-yl)biphenyl (CBP). 6FCBP was employed to fabricate OLEDs by spin coating or vacuum deposition with excellent performance.
